  • Denver International Airport (DEN) is beginning the next step for Peña Boulevard, building on the recently completed Peña Boulevard Master Plan.

    This stage—the National Environmental Policy Act (NEPA) review—will take a closer look at possible improvements, study how they may affect people and the environment, and gather input from the community. The NEPA process will take about two years, after which DEN will be ready to move forward with designing and building improvements.

    Peña Boulevard is long overdue for upgrades, and your feedback will help shape the future of this critical connection to the airport and surrounding communities. This survey is an opportunity to share how you use Peña Boulevard today, what challenges you face, and what priorities you think should guide future improvements.
